Episode 7.12: Fracture
Airdate: February 14, 2008

02/06 - An amnesiac Kara will put Lex thisclose to uncovering Krypton's secrets. A hot scene between Green Arrow and Lois turns into a threesome even a superhero would have a hard time with. Source: Ask Ausiello @ TV Guide
02/06 - Lex's search for Kara takes a deadly turn when he finds the amnesiac superheroine hanging out in Detroit with a gun-toting stalker-crazy busboy. Once the bullets start flying, however, the bald bad boy learns just how far he's fallen once Clark decides he's done saving his frienemy's hide. Source: TV Guide
01/28 - Lois follows Lex to Detroit and discovers he has found Kara, who has amnesia. Finley (guest star Corey Sevier), a busboy who is obsessed with Kara, fears Lex will take her away, so he shoots Lex and holds Kara and Lois captive. After Lex's comatose body is found, Chloe offers to heal him, but Clark refuses to let her. Kristin Kreuk, Aaron Ashmore and John Glover also star. Source: The CW
01/23 - Lois plays an important role in finding the missing Kara. In trying to save Lex, it sounds like Clark will enter Lex's mind much like John Jones rescued Clark in "Labyrinth." While "inside," Clark encounters a side of Lex that he thought was gone forever. Source: KryptonSite
12/26 - Corey Sevier has noted on his official website that he will be guest starring in this episode. We are assuming this is in the role of "Jacob Finn." Source: KryptonSite
12/13 - The amnesiac Kara goes by the name "Linda," kind of a nod to the "Linda Lee Danvers" persona from the comics. Aaron Ashmore (Jimmy) does not appear in this episode. Source: KryptonSite
11/03 - As with "Lexmas," Lex's mother Lillian factors in to the story. Remember how, for "Persona," we talked about someone being shot as if it was a common occurrence? Well, it happens again here, and this time, yet again, it's Lex. It sounds like this will be another "Lexmas"-style jaunt into Lex's psyche. Casting notices have gone out for "Alexander," which sounds like it will be a representation of Lex's younger self. Another role being cast is for a character named "Jacob Finn," but we don't know anything about him. Source: KryptonSite


Episode 7.13: Hero
Airdate: March 13, 2008

12/26 - Pete's stretching ability comes from meteor-laced chewing gum. Source: KryptonSite
12/13 - Finally, IGN.com has confirmed who the "hero" will be - Pete Ross, returning to Smallville for the first time since Season 3's "Forsaken." Pete won't really like the changes that have gone on since he left town. He's surprised to learn that Chloe, Lana, and Lionel all know Clark's secret - and he's especially surprised to find Lionel Luthor hanging out at the Kents' home. Much like a Season 1 "freak of the week" story, Pete obtains temporary "Elastic Lad"-like stretching powers thanks to something involving meteor rocks. He's using these powers when he saves the lives of Kara and Jimmy. Lex uses Pete's past feelings for Chloe to his advantage. Pete may have some unresolved bad feelings about keeping Clark's secret and the direction it has taken in his life. Part of this episode takes place at a concert. A "muscle-clad henchman," a "roadie," and a "drummer" are currently being cast. Source: KryptonSite
11/11 - The character who makes a guest appearance is male. Source: KryptonSite
11/03 - The guest character ends up saving the lives of two other characters and is quickly deemed a "hero." The guest character first exhibits powers in this story thanks to a Kryptonite plot device that may stretch your imagination a little bit, but it's still fun. Jimmy thinks this person's power is "cool," which makes Chloe question her decision not to tell him about her meteor-based ability. Erica Durance (Lois) does not appear in this episode. Lex tries to use this newly-supowerpowered person to his advantage. A character that fans have been wanting to see on Smallville for the past few seasons should be appearing in this one. Source: KryptonSite


Episode 7.14: Traveler
Airdate: March 20, 2008

01/10 - Gina Holden's official website has revealed that she will be playing a role on Smallville that is now filming. We're assuming she will be playing Patricia Swann. Source: KryptonSite
12/26 - Aaron Douglas of Battlestar Galactica fame has booked a guest role on Smallville, which we are assuming is the role of the previously-mentioned "Pierce." Douglas has actually appeared on Smallville before, in the first season episode "Obscura." Allison Mack and Kristin Kreuk have said in recent interviews that they'd gotten to work together again, and that there's an episode where they work with Laura Vandervoort and the three of them (Chloe, Lana, and Kara) have a sort of "girl power team up." This is the episode they were talking about. Source: KryptonSite
12/13 - "Traveler" is about Patricia Swann, daughter of Dr. Swann and a childhood friend of Lex's. Swann and Lionel were part of a group who were waiting for the arrival of an extra-terrestrial "traveler". Patricia wants to stay in touch with Clark because she believes he can do good for the world. Another character currently being cast is "Pierce," who fears aliens, and kidnaps Clark and keeps him in a specially built prison. Chloe and Lana work together to rescue Clark. Source: KryptonSite
11/11 - Expect episodes 7.14 and 7.15 to explore some long-standing elements and arcs in the overall Smallville mythology. Things that happened in past seasons will finally come together, in a storyline heavily involving Clark as well as the Luthors. Source: KryptonSite


Episode 7.15: Veritas [Last episode completed before the writers' strike]
Airdate: March 27, 2008

01/23 - Jane Seymour (Genevieve Teague) won't be back after all. We might meet Jason's father instead. The presence of Brainiac takes place in the present day, not in a flashback. Chloe isn't the only one to have words with Lionel in this episode. Expect Lex and Lois to also have dialogue with the elder Luthor. Source: KryptonSite
01/10 - Even though Clark and Lana have some bumps after the whole Bizarro thing, it sounds like they will still be in a relationship by season's end. The big cliffhangers, and the episode itself, deal more with the mythology of the series than the romantic relationships. There's a lot of big stuff on the way though... Source: KryptonSite
12/13 - Roles currently being cast for "Veritas" include Robert Queen, Young Jason Teague, Young Oliver Queen, and Young Patricia Swann. Yes, it is a flashback, and the villain from Smallville's past that might be back is Genevieve Teague (Jane Syemour). She's is the casting sides at the very least. The scene in question is a flashback to when Lionel, Swann, the Queens, and the Teagues were all working together in the late 1980s. Lois and Jimmy work together on a story. In addition to Brainiac, another villain from Smallville's past might be back in this one. Chloe and Lionel have a confrontation about his true motivations. Source: KryptonSite
11/11 - If the WGA writers' strike continues through to the end of the season, this could be the season finale. It is said to end on some cliffhangers "just in case." Source: KryptonSite
